Find x if:

B is between A and C;

AB=x+5;

BC=2(x – 3); and

AB ≅ BC .

Answer:

x = 11

Step-by-step explanation:

x + 5 = 2(x - 3)

x + 5 = 2x - 6

(x - x) + 5 = (2x - x) - 6

5 = x - 6

5 + 6 = x (- 6 + 6)

x = 11
